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• 스프링의 역사
    웹 개발/스프링 2024. 10. 7. 16:59

     

    ejb라는 개발자들의 겨울에서
    봄이 왔다 라는 의미를 담아 만들어짐


    ejb는 자바 진영의 표준 기술중 최고봉(그 당시)이었으나 비싸고 복잡하고 느렸음
    그래서 돈많은 금융권같은데서나 씀
    또 코드를 ejb 의존적으로 쓰다보니
    너무 지저분해지기 때문에

    순수하게 옛날 자바로 돌아가자 
    라는 뜻에서 POJO(Plain Old Java Object)라는 용어가 나옴
    그러나 옛날 orm 기술은 수준 자체가 낮았다고 함(조인이 잘 안먹음)

    그래서 
    Hibernate를 만든 개빈킹
    스프링 프레임을 만든 로드 존슨
    두사람이 오픈소스를 만들어서
    책도쓰고 코드도 푸는데 이게 미래의 스프링이 됨

    이러한 스프링도 점차 발전해 나갔는데 

    톰캣과 같은 웹서버에다가 스프링war를 빌드해서 집어넣어야 하는 과정이

    너무 복잡했으나 서버를 내장해서 편하게 띄우는 그런 유행을 받아들여 만들어진게

    바로 스프링부트

    Spring Boot

    라고 한다고 합니다~

    '웹 개발 > 스프링' 카테고리의 다른 글

    좋은 객체지향 프로그래밍(Object Oriented Programming)이란  (0) 2024.10.20
    VO, DTO, ENTITY?  (0) 2023.06.19
    스프링  (0) 2023.06.01
    스프링  (0) 2023.04.04
    ajax  (0) 2023.04.04
Designed by Tistory.